在当今数据驱动的世界中,数据库管理系统 (DBMS) 对于组织和管理企业数据至关重要。Microsoft Access 是一个流行的 DBMS,但了解其底层数据库类型对于有效利用其功能非常重要。本文将深入探讨 Access 所属的数据库类型,并阐述其特点和优点。
Access 的数据库类型
Microsoft Access 使用一种称为Jet Engine的专有数据库引擎。Jet Engine 是一个关系型数据库引擎,这意味着它存储数据以二维表的形式,其中每一行表示一条记录,每一列表示该记录的一个属性。
Jet Engine 本身包括两个数据库文件类型:在线字数统计?
- .mdb 文件:Microsoft Access 97 及更早版本使用的 Access 数据库文件格式。
- .accdb 文件:Microsoft Access 2007 及更高版本使用的 Access 数据库文件格式。
关系型数据库的特点
关系型数据库具有以下特点:
- 数据以二维表的形式存储:数据存储在行和列中,其中每一行表示一条记录,每一列表示一个属性。
- 记录具有唯一标识符:每一行(记录)都有一个或多个字段,这些字段共同唯一标识该记录。
- 表之间的关系:表可以通过外键关联起来,这允许在表之间建立关系并查询和维护数据。
Jet Engine 的优势
Jet Engine 提供了几个优势,使其成为 Access 数据库的理想选择:
- 紧凑和便携:Jet Engine 数据库文件通常比其他 DBMS 的文件小,使其易于分发和共享。
- 易于使用:Access 提供了一个直观的用户界面,使创建和维护数据库变得简单,即使对于没有技术背景的人也是如此。
- 本地存储:Jet Engine 数据库通常存储在本地计算机上,这提供了快速的数据访问和更高的安全性。
- 可扩展性:尽管 Jet Engine 专为小型到中型数据库而设计,但它可以在一定程度上进行扩展,以处理更大的数据集。
Access 的局限性
虽然 Jet Engine 对于大多数 Access 用户而言是一个强大的选择,但它也有一些局限性:王利!HTML在线运行?
- 并发用户限制:Jet Engine 数据库一次只能支持有限数量的并发用户,这可能会限制大型或繁忙的应用程序。
- 扩展性限制:虽然 Jet Engine 可以扩展,但它不如其他 DBMS,例如 SQL Server 或 Oracle,那样可扩展。
- 缺乏高级功能:Jet Engine 缺少某些高级功能,例如存储过程或触发器,这可能会限制某些应用程序的开发。
结论
Microsoft Access 的 Jet Engine 是一个紧凑、易于使用且可扩展的关系型数据库引擎,使其成为小型到中型数据库管理的理想选择。虽然它有一些局限性,但它仍然是一种强大的工具,可以满足广泛的用户需求。通过了解 Access 所属的数据库类型,组织可以做出明智的决策,选择最适合其特定需求的 DBMS。wangli!
常见问答
-
Access 数据库文件有哪些格式?
- .mdb(Access 97 及更早版本)
- .accdb(Access 2007 及更高版本)
-
Jet Engine 是哪种类型的数据库引擎?
- 关系型数据库引擎
-
Jet Engine 数据库的优势是什么?
- 紧凑便携、易于使用、本地存储、一定程度的可扩展性
-
Jet Engine 数据库的局限性是什么?JS转Excel?
- 并发用户限制、扩展性限制、缺乏高级功能
-
Access 的 Jet Engine 适合哪些类型的应用程序?SEO?
- 小型到中型数据库管理、个人应用程序、小型业务应用程序
原创文章,作者:诸葛武凡,如若转载,请注明出处:https://www.wanglitou.cn/article_101057.html